User CryptorClub paid them for their services listing on CoinGecko,
I don't get why certain people, pay for something that's free while also not doing a little research about the platforms they're planning to get listed on:

I think the main reason why people paid the service is to get the volume assistant as well as get through --presumably in a dirty way-- the other requirements that coingecko didn't disclose

Once you have verified that the exchange is tracked on CoinGecko, do fill up our Request Form. Listings will have to fulfill an internal set of criteria before it is listed on CoinGecko. These criteria will not be disclosed.

which, from what I can conclude from the wild, wild, wild quote-pyramid on the earlier scam accusation, includes: a thin spread, certain amount of highest bid and lowest ask, and a high daily trading volume... as well as team details. I can see that a high daily trading volume would be a difficult criteria for a low quality project due to the scarce numbers of people interested to buy and sell them, which is why they'll need a good volume assistance (A.K.A.: trading bot).
